History and Cultural Significance
The origins of the Spanish dancer costume are deeply rooted in the history of flamenco dance. Flamenco emerged in Andalusia, southern Spain, in the 18th century, drawing influences from various cultures, including Spanish, Romani, Jewish, and Moorish traditions. The evolution of the costume reflects the evolution of the dance itself. Early flamenco dancers often wore simple attire, but as the dance gained popularity, the costumes became more elaborate and expressive. The bright colors, flowing skirts, and intricate details of the costumes were designed to enhance the dancer's movements and visually represent the passion and drama of flamenco. These outfits were not just clothing, they were a statement, a visual representation of the dancer's artistry and the dance's cultural significance. Classic Flamenco Dress
The classic flamenco dress is a timeless choice, and a total showstopper! These dresses typically feature a fitted bodice, a flared skirt with multiple ruffles, and often come in vibrant colors like red, black, or even a polka-dotted pattern. They're designed to enhance the dancer's movements and make them look absolutely stunning. The skirts swirl beautifully as the kids dance, making every twirl and step even more captivating. These dresses often include details such as lace, frills, and decorative embellishments, to make the outfit stand out. The classic dress is an excellent choice for any event where a touch of elegance and tradition is desired. They're perfect for performances, Halloween, or simply for playing dress-up at home.

Sizing and Fit Considerations for Kids
Getting the right size is crucial for any costume, especially a dancing one! Here's what you need to keep in mind when choosing the right size for your ikinder spanische tnzerin kostm.
Measuring Your Child
Before you purchase, take your child's measurements. You'll need their height, chest, waist, and hip measurements. Use a measuring tape and record the numbers carefully. This will help you compare your child's measurements to the size charts provided by the retailers. Make sure to measure with your child wearing light clothing, as this will give you the most accurate results. This will ensure a comfortable and well-fitting costume. Knowing your child's measurements will make the shopping process much smoother and reduce the chances of having to return the costume later.
Understanding Size Charts
Every retailer has its own size chart, so always refer to the specific chart provided for the costume you're considering. Size charts typically list measurements for different sizes, such as small, medium, and large. Be sure to check the size chart carefully before making a purchase, paying attention to the measurements that correspond to your child's measurements. When in doubt, it's often better to size up, as it's easier to alter a costume that's slightly too big than one that's too small. This gives your child room to move comfortably and allows for layering if needed. Always check the retailer's return policy in case the costume doesn't fit quite right.

Caring for and Maintaining the Costume
Once you've found the perfect ikinder spanische tnzerin kostm, you'll want to take good care of it to ensure it lasts! Here are some tips for maintaining and cleaning your child's costume.
Washing and Cleaning Instructions
Always follow the washing instructions provided on the costume's label. Some costumes can be machine-washed, while others need to be hand-washed or dry-cleaned. Before washing, spot-clean any stains with a mild detergent. If machine washing, use a gentle cycle and cold water. Avoid using harsh detergents or bleach, as these can damage the fabric and colors. For hand-washing, use cool water and a mild soap. Rinse thoroughly and gently squeeze out excess water. Always hang the costume to air dry, and avoid putting it in the dryer, as this can shrink or damage the fabric. Washing the costume correctly will extend its life and keep it looking its best. Proper care ensures the costume stays in great condition for future use, and keeps it ready for the next performance or party.
Storage Tips
Store the costume in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. Hang the costume on a padded hanger to prevent wrinkles and maintain its shape. If you're storing the costume for an extended period, consider placing it in a garment bag to protect it from dust and insects. Avoid storing the costume in plastic bags, as this can trap moisture. Make sure the costume is completely dry before storing it, and check it periodically for any signs of damage. Storing the costume properly will protect it from damage and help it last for years to come. Proper storage will keep your child's costume in excellent condition, ready to be worn again for future occasions.
